How To Rename Your AirPods: Step-by-Step Guide for Every Device

1. On Your iPhone: A Quick Change

Ready to make your AirPods stand out on your iPhone? It’s just a few taps away:

  1. Connect Your AirPods: Turn on Bluetooth and take your AirPods out of their case. If they don’t connect automatically, head to Settings > Bluetooth.
  2. Access AirPods Settings: Once connected, tap the info icon next to your AirPods.
  3. Rename and Done: Tap their current name, enter your awesome new name, hit “Done,” and voilà!

Remember, if you’re using the same Apple ID, this new name will pop up on all your Apple devices.

2. On Android Devices: Personalize on Each Device

Even Android users can jump into the renaming fun:

  1. Go to Bluetooth Settings: Long-press the Bluetooth icon, turn it on, and wait for your AirPods to appear.
  2. Rename Your AirPods: Tap the gear icon next to your AirPods, select “Rename,” give them a new identity, and hit “Rename” again.

Note: This change is device-specific. If you use multiple devices, you’ll need to rename them on each one.

3. On a Windows PC: Customize for Your Computer

Renaming on Windows is easy, but it’ll only show on your PC:

  1. Open Control Panel: Go to the Windows menu, find “Control Panel,” and select “Devices and Printers.”
  2. Find Your AirPods: Look for them in the Bluetooth devices list.
  3. Edit and Apply: Right-click, choose “Properties,” go to the “Bluetooth” tab, change the name, and hit “Apply” then “OK.”

4. On an iPad: Just Like Your iPhone

Your iPad makes it just as easy:

  1. Connect Your AirPods: Enable Bluetooth, take your AirPods out, and connect.
  2. Tap to Rename: In Settings > Bluetooth, tap the info icon next to your AirPods, change the name, and tap “Done.”

5. On a Mac: Sync Across All Apple Devices

Renaming on a Mac ensures the name updates on all your Apple gadgets:

  1. Pair to Your Mac: Turn on Bluetooth and connect your AirPods.
  2. Rename via System Preferences: Click the Apple menu, go to System Preferences > Bluetooth, right-click your AirPods, select “Rename,” and confirm your new name.

6. On a Chromebook: Using an Apple Device

Chromebooks don’t directly support renaming, but you can use an Apple device:

  • For iPhone Users: Activate Bluetooth, connect your AirPods, and in Settings > Bluetooth, tap the info icon next to your AirPods to rename.
  • For Mac Users: Turn on Bluetooth, connect your AirPods, click the Apple logo > System Preferences > Bluetooth, right-click your AirPods, and rename.

After these steps, your Chromebook will recognize the new name next time you connect.
